It took 3 gallons of gas to drive 66 miles ( 318 - 252) since the gas tank had 6 gallons after traversing that distance. If you divide 66 by 3 you get 22 miles, which means the rate is 22 miles per gallon. Feel free to contact me if you would like to schedule a tutoring session !
